About this experience
During the private tour by comfortable air-conditioned car, you will visit Etna - the highest active volcano in Europe. This tour is private - only for your party, nobody else to ensure the highest standards for our clients. Your friendly private guide will tell you history of volcano creation, about eruptions, culture, myths, and folklore of "Mamma Etna" and Sicily itself. Driving by private car through authentic mountain villages, you will reach “Rifugio Sapienza” at 2000mt. Here you can visit famous Silvestri Craters, admire unforgettable panoramas, visit shops with souvenirs of lava, refresh yourself at some restaurant or bar. Optional ascent with cable car and jeep with the authorized Alpine Guide to 3000mt. Then you will visit one of the best Etna wineries and have lunch of fresh local food with fine red and white Sicilian wines. What you'll see and do
Catania
Your personal tour leader will pick you up at your accommodation/port in Catania, and you will start your wonderful private travel to the highest active volcano in Europe. Driving by comfortable, air-conditioned car through the small authentic mountain villages, you will admire unforgettable picturesque views of Sicilian countryside full of oranges and lemon plantations, olives and almond trees, houses and churches built of lava stone. Enjoying amazing sea view and lava fields, you will arrive to a charming mountain town Zafferana Etnea, where you will visit local honey store and taste the produce of the fertile volcano land - honey, olive oils, olives, wines and liquors. We recommend wearing comfortable closed-toe shoes and bringing extra layers, such as something warm and a windbreaker or rain jacket, to be prepared for changing weather conditions.
Pass by without stopping
Mount Etna
You will continue to ascend Etna reaching "Rifugio Sapienza" station at 2000mt. Here you can visit famous Silvestri Craters, admire breathtaking panoramas, visit souvenir shops offering gifts of lava, refresh yourself in some bar or restaurant. Optional ascent by cable car/4X4 with an authorized Alpine guide to 3000mt. After visiting Mt.Etna, the guide will chauffeur you in relax to one of the best wineries on Etna slope. At the winery you will have will have a tour of the estate, see how the grape is growing, and visit the cellars, while the expert sommelier explains you all about the wine making process and the history of this family run winery. Then you will have traditional delicious lunch of locally produced cheeses, salami, prosciutto, fresh bread, olives and home-made olive oil and a typical pasta dish. A professional sommelier will offer you 4 glasses of Sicilian Etna red and white wines. After the tour, your guide will drop you off at your accommodation or port in Catania.
